It's everywhere!: Gozo Glass
krissyM profile photo
krissyM 281 reviews

Glass blowing on the islands of Malta is a tradition steep in history. The diverse colors are inspired by the blue and green waters of the Mediterranean the sandy beaches and the beautiful sunsets.

Gozo Glass is a locally owned family business established in 1989, employing a team of craftsmen from nearby villages at the western end of this tiny nine by four and a half mile island.

You can buy anything from paperweights costing a few dollars to large bowls and vases costing a few hundred dollars. I settled for something in between, a perfume decanter to add to my collection from around the world.

What to buy: Glass of course :)

Xlendi – shopping for knitted jackets
Diana75 profile photo

3.5 out of 5 starsHelpfulness

Diana75 1519 reviews
Shops in Xlendi

What to buy: The most authentic "Gozitan" souvenir is definitely Gozo lace. All over the island are small shops selling beautiful lace items and in some of them can be also seen old ladies showing how the lace is done.

Knitted jackets are also on sale everywhere in Gozo.

In Xlendi in particular I found a couple of small shops, located on the promenade or near the central square, selling some beautiful and colorful knitted jackets.

Small ornamental objects made of Gozo limestone are also available in shops, as are glass and clay ornaments.

Victoria open market
Diana75 profile photo

3.5 out of 5 starsHelpfulness

Diana75 1519 reviews
Victoria open market

Even though Gozo is pretty small, there are a certain number of small shops, mini-markets and lately some renowned European chain outlets have also opened in Gozo.

In Victoria's main square, Pjazza Indipendenza, is a traditional open market.

Shops generally open Monday to Fridays between 08:00 – 12:30 and 16:00 – 19:00. Saturdays, most shops open only till 12:00.

Fresh fruits, honey and home made syrup
Diana75 profile photo

3.5 out of 5 starsHelpfulness

Diana75 1519 reviews
Fresh fruits, honey and home made syrup
1 more image

What to buy: Gozo's honey is famous.

The ones who want to bring something specific from Gozo back home can buy thyme honey or Carob syrup from the peddlers displaying their products near the temples in Ggantija.

Another tasty attraction here are the cactus's fruits, which for a couple of liras can be also bought from these sellers.

Noel Store: Local Foodstuffs
Xemx profile photo

4.5 out of 5 starsHelpfulness

Xemx 74 reviews
Noel Store (on the right)

When I'm in Gozo I like to stop at this tiny store and pick up a few goodies to take back home with me in Malta. Everything is locally made and tastes wonderfully fresh. There is a lot to choose from and all look yummy so I have a tendency to take one of each!

What to buy: Apart from fresh fruit and vegetables, you can find a selection of preserves. On my last visit, I picked up some Helwa with chocolate (this is a sweet made out of Tahini, sugar, almonds and covered with chocolate), large fruit capers, a jar of dried tomatoes and some pure honey.

What to pay: The Helwa with chocolate cost Lm1.25, the large fruit capers 50cents, the dried tomatoes Lm1.25 and the pure honey Lm1.50.

Lacemakers
joanj profile photo
joanj 618 reviews
lacemaker at work

As with Malta itself, Gozo is also known for it's lace.

There are also many small stalls to buy from, and as is shown in the picture, sometimes the ladies are on the street doing their lacemaking.

I had permission to take this ladies photograph having talked to her for quite a while and bought some lace from her. She started learning the craft of lacemaking when she was 10 years old.

What to pay: various prices, but nothing extortionate.
